5836089d37f37-2Jerry E. Buck, 43, of Oil City, died at 5:25 p.m. on Tuesday, November 22, 2016 at the Shippenville Health and Rehab Center.

He was born in Oil City on December 2, 1972 to the late Foster Leroy and Linda L. (Sanner) Buck.

Jerry graduated from Cranberry High School and studied auto-body at the Vo-Tech.

In his earlier years, he attended Faith Baptist Church in Seneca.

Jerry enjoyed hunting, fishing, and spending time with his family and friends.

Mr. Buck previously had worked at Riddle Brothers Auto Body in Franklin, and also at Penn Fencing.

He is survived by his daughter, Brittney Hepler of Oil City; two grandchildren, Haylie and Kendall Hepler; two brothers, John Buck and his significant other, Robin Hutchinson of Rouseville , and Jamey Buck of Oil City; and two nephews, Michael and Randy.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by a sister, Sandy Buck.

A memorial service will be held Sunday (Nov. 27th) at 4 p.m. in the Hile-Best Funeral Home, 2781 Rte. 257 in Seneca, Cranberry Township. Rev. Larry Williams, pastor of Faith Baptist Church will officiate.

Private interment will be in Brandon Cemetery at a later date.
